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
460671 430528 8810448 7681
3255223 81940758 7223734592
3255223 81940758 7223734592
5023 78 68254964622 430104
All about undefined
Interested in learning more?
3255223 81940758 7223734592
5023 78 68254964622 430104
See more
3576853349 1236
934238 02841 29
See more
64 331293569 73863
827113280 334 4339356 5689 6070361
See more